| Aspect | Vice President Workforce Economic Development | Workforce Program Manager |
|---|
| Credentials | Bachelor's or Master's degree in related field, extensive experience | Bachelor's degree, relevant certifications often preferred |
| Work Environment | Executive-level, strategic planning, leadership roles | Operational, project management, program implementation |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Used in government agencies, large nonprofits, economic development organizations | Used in community colleges, workforce agencies, nonprofits |
The Vice President Workforce Economic Development focuses on strategic leadership and high-level planning to promote workforce initiatives, while the Workforce Program Manager handles day-to-day program operations and implementation. Both roles are vital but differ in scope, responsibilities, and required experience.
